Commingling is the illegal act of mixing client trust funds with a broker's personal or business operating funds; conversion is the misappropriation of those funds.

Continuing education (CE) refers to the ongoing coursework that licensed real estate professionals must complete during each renewal cycle to maintain an active license. CE ensures agents stay current with changes in laws, regulations, and industry practices.

The National Do Not Call Registry is a federal program administered by the FTC that allows consumers to opt out of receiving unsolicited telemarketing calls, including calls from real estate agents soliciting business.
